Why a 1 Horsepower Above Ground Pool Pump Is Necessary

From my experience, a 1 horsepower above ground pool pump is necessary because it gives my pool the right balance of power and efficiency. I’ve found that smaller pumps often struggle to move enough water, especially when the pool gets used a lot or when debris starts building up. With a 1 HP pump, my water circulates properly, which helps keep it cleaner and more comfortable for swimming.

I also like that a 1 horsepower pump helps my pool’s filtration system work better. When the water moves at a steady and strong rate, my filter can catch dirt, leaves, and other particles more effectively. That means I spend less time dealing with cloudy water and more time enjoying the pool. It also helps distribute chemicals evenly, so my water stays balanced and safer.

Another reason I consider it necessary is durability and convenience. In my case, a 1 HP pump handles everyday pool maintenance without constantly overworking. That gives me peace of mind, knowing my pump can support the pool’s needs during hot weather and heavy use. Overall, it’s a practical choice that helps me maintain cleaner water, better circulation, and a more enjoyable swimming experience.

What I Looked for in Performance

The first thing I checked was how well the pump could move water. In my experience, a pump should circulate the entire pool water regularly to help the filter do its job. I paid attention to flow rate, head pressure, and whether the pump could handle my pool size. I also made sure the pump was strong enough to support skimmers, filters, and any pool accessories I use.

Why Pool Size Matters to Me

I learned quickly that not every 1 horsepower pump fits every pool. For my above-ground pool, I had to match the pump to the water capacity. If the pump is too weak, the water stays cloudy. If it is too powerful, it can create unnecessary strain on the system. I found it important to choose a pump that matched my pool’s gallons and filtration setup.

Energy Efficiency Was Important in My Decision

I always try to think beyond the purchase price. A pump runs for hours every day, so electricity use matters to me. I looked for a model that offered good performance without driving up my utility bill. In my experience, energy-efficient pumps and well-designed motors can save money over time, even if the upfront cost is a little higher.

Noise Level Made a Difference for Me

I did not want a pump that sounded like heavy machinery running in my backyard. I paid close attention to reviews about noise because I wanted something quieter and more pleasant to live with. A pump with a smoother motor and solid housing made a big difference in my overall satisfaction.

Durability and Build Quality I Trusted

Since a pool pump is exposed to water, sun, and outdoor conditions, I wanted one built to last. I looked for corrosion-resistant materials, a sturdy housing, and a motor designed for long-term use. In my experience, a pump with strong construction saves me from frequent repairs and early replacement.

Ease of Installation and Maintenance

I prefer equipment that does not make setup complicated. I checked whether the pump was easy to install with my existing plumbing and whether the basket, lid, and connections were simple to access. I also looked for a design that made cleaning and routine maintenance easier because I know I will need to service it regularly.

Compatibility with My Filtration System

One thing I did not overlook was compatibility. My pump needed to work well with my filter type, hoses, and fittings. I made sure the pump size and connections matched my setup so I would not have to buy extra adapters or deal with performance issues later.

Safety Features I Wanted

Safety mattered to me, especially with electrical equipment near water. I looked for features like overload protection and secure wiring requirements. I also made sure I understood proper grounding and installation guidelines before using the pump. That gave me more confidence in day-to-day operation.
